Pros & cons summary


Maximum RAM amount 10 GB 12 GB
Chip lithography 16 nm 8 nm
Power consumption (TDP) 250 Watt 170 Watt

RTX 3060 has a 20% higher maximum VRAM amount, a 100% more advanced lithography process, and 47.1% lower power consumption.

We couldn't decide between P102-101 and GeForce RTX 3060. We've got no test results to judge.

Be aware that P102-101 is a workstation graphics card while GeForce RTX 3060 is a desktop one.
